Adjusting the operation of a wire section, in which the development of the consistency of stock on the wire section (2) is determined and the effect of the consistency determined above on the formation and/or porosity of a paper web (3) is determined. The consistency developed on the wire section is adjusted based on a quality property of paper and/or by optimising a cost function, the quality property of paper comprising the formation and/or the porosity and/or a combination defined by means of the formation and/or the porosity and the cost function including the effect of at least the formation and/or the porosity.
The invention relates to an apparatus for assessing the condition of at least one circulating band in a papermaking machine including a permeability measuring device, a moisture measuring device, a fiber web moisture measuring device, an evaluator, a reel-up and an other moisture measuring device. The permeability measuring device measures the permeability of the at least one circulating band. The moisture measuring device measures the moisture contained in the at least one circulating band. The fiber web moisture measuring device measures the moisture of the fiber web. The evaluator combines the permeability, the moisture of the at least one circulating band and the moisture of the fiber web to determine the condition of the at least one circulating band. The other moisture measurement device is coupled to the reel-up, and takes a moisture measurement of the fiber web made by the papermaking machine.
